Intuitively, my guess is that you're probably better off getting a player with bass management, instead of using the receiver's, anyway. Otherwise, the receiver may have to convert the analog signal to digital first (and then back to analog) in order to apply any bass management. The player, on the other hand, can apply bass management to the original digital content.

Darryl is correct, I think. The answer is, you don't need receiver bass management when you play SACD or DVD-A, it is all done in the player. It has to be. That 7.1 analogue input to the receiver is like the CD input, only with more channels. That is to say, the signal enters the receiver in the analogue domain and stays there, just getting amplified. Very well, in any NAD, imho. You would not wish to convert it back to digital for processing.

Equally, EARS gives a nice matrixed, simulated 5.1 from stereo sources, but it works in the digital domain, and nothing like that (Prologic etc. ) compares with the sound quality of a real, multi-channel source. So you don't need EARS with DVD-A or SACD.
